有什么故障排除和日志分析的工具
时间: 2023-05-18 22:06:23 浏览: 97
可以使用的故障排除和日志分析工具有很多,其中比较常用的包括:
1. Wireshark:用于网络协议分析和故障排除,可以捕获和分析网络数据包。
2. Nagios:用于监控系统和网络设备,可以实时检测并报告故障。
3. Logstash:用于日志收集、处理和分析,可以将各种来源的日志数据聚合到一起,并进行分析和可视化。
4. Splunk:用于大规模数据分析和可视化,可以对各种类型的数据进行搜索、分析和报告。
5. ELK Stack:由Elasticsearch、Logstash和Kibana三个开源工具组成,用于日志收集、处理和可视化。
6. Graylog:用于日志收集、处理和分析,可以对各种类型的日志数据进行搜索、过滤和可视化。
以上是一些常用的故障排除和日志分析工具,具体选择哪个工具需要根据实际情况进行评估和选择。
相关问题
网络故障排除的基本程序步骤和常用命令。
网络故障排查是网络管理和维护中的重要部分,以下是网络故障排除的基本程序步骤和常用命令:
1. 确认故障现象:根据用户反馈或系统监视工具等,确认网络故障的具体现象和范围。
2. 收集信息:收集和记录故障的详细信息,包括时间、地点、受影响的设备或用户等。
3. 分析故障原因:通过分析网络拓扑、设备配置、日志文件等,找出故障的根本原因。
4. 解决问题:根据故障原因采取相应的措施,解决网络故障。
5. 验证解决方案:验证解决方案是否有效,恢复网络服务。
在网络故障排查中,还可以使用一些常用命令,如下:
1. ping命令:测试网络连接是否正常,检测主机之间的连通性。
2. tracert命令:跟踪网络数据包在互联网中的路径。
3. ipconfig命令:查看和配置本地网络连接的IP地址、子网掩码、默认网关等信息。
4. netstat命令:用于显示网络连接、路由表、网络接口等信息。
5. nslookup命令:用于查询DNS服务器的IP地址和域名解析信息。
6. arp命令:用于显示和修改本地ARP高速缓存中的内容,可以查询到本地主机的MAC地址。
7. nbtstat命令:用于显示NetBIOS名称缓存、NetBIOS名称表、NetBIOS会话列表等信息。
以上命令在网络故障排查和网络管理中都很有用,可以帮助管理员快速诊断和解决问题。
linux 网络故障排除
Linux网络故障排除是一项很重要的技能,特别是对于网络管理员来说。以下是一些常见的故障排除步骤:
1. 检查网络连接:首先,检查是否已正确连接到网络,检查链路状态、IP地址、网关、DNS等信息是否设置正确。可以使用ifconfig、ip、route、ping等命令。
2. 检查网络服务:检查各个网络服务是否已启动,如网络服务、DNS服务、DHCP服务、NTP服务等。可以使用systemctl、service等命令。
3. 检查防火墙:如果有防火墙,检查防火墙是否已正确配置,是否阻止了需要的流量。可以使用iptables、firewall-cmd等命令。
4. 检查网络硬件:检查网络硬件是否正常工作,如网卡、交换机、路由器等。可以使用ifconfig、ethtool、mii-tool等命令。
5. 检查日志:查看系统日志,寻找可能存在的网络故障原因。可以使用journalctl、dmesg等命令。
6. 使用网络工具:使用网络诊断工具如traceroute、tcpdump、wireshark等,分析网络流量,查找故障原因。
以上是一些常见的网络故障排除步骤,但具体的排除方法会根据不同的故障情况而有所不同。